Private Capital Data Analytics Platform Aumni Raises $10 Million Series A

share on

Salt Lake City, Utah (January 28, 2020) - Aumni, Inc., a SaaS company developing a robotic process automation and data analytics platform for private capital investors, announced a $10 million Series A funding round led by SVB Financial Group, the parent company of Silicon Valley Bank. The round also included participation from existing investors Moneta Ventures, Next Frontier Capital and Quiet Ventures, who together previously led Aumni’s $3.7 million Series Seed round. New investors also include Kickstart Seed Fund, Blackhorn Ventures, Prelude and Service Provider Capital. This announcement follows a pivotal year of growth and achievement for Aumni with its core product offering poised for scale and expansion in 2020.

About Aumni:

Aumni was founded by Anthony Lewis and Kelsey Chase, two attorneys from top corporate law firms Latham & Watkins, Wilson Sonsini and DLA Piper. Aumni is solving a common pain point for investors in private capital markets by developing a turn-key SaaS platform that extracts, audits, and tracks thousands of investment data points directly from definitive investment agreements. Today, Aumni works with prestigious traditional venture funds, corporate venture funds and family offices and is quickly becoming the standard for automating legal operations and investment data analytics for private capital markets.
